  • Regular Member
6 minutes ago, Ccd99 said:

The title mentions 9k grafts? I looked at his pre-op photos and his donor was already thin to begin with, especially considering he is not using any medication.

I am not trying to be negative, just realistic. I think you would struggle to harvest another 3-4k grafts from the donor scalp without causing visible scarring - see recent photo below:

image.png.00d4456878841ea9e5d5649aa18afc9b.png

But of course if he has sufficient beard hair then yes can always extract from there.

Eh I think people are way too conservative with donor harvesting. Dr. Zarev got 9.7k from just scalp out of this patient who had a worse donor: https://www.instagram.com/p/CzgSB_VK2M7/?igsh=d3R5NjM0ajhpMmdj
